New drug Rina-S shows promise in lung cancer trial
NCT ID NCT07288177
First seen Dec 29, 2025 · Last updated May 01, 2026 · Updated 18 times
Summary
This study tests a new drug called Rina-S in about 240 people with advanced non-small cell lung cancer. The goal is to see if Rina-S can shrink tumors or slow cancer growth. All participants receive the active drug, and treatment may continue as long as it helps and side effects are manageable.
